2 years ago I thought I'd bought a 200TDi Defender. The fan belt snapped the other day so I bought a replacement. Reading the Haynes manual the fan belt arrangement would appear to be off the 19J engine. Certainly picture 18.10 on page 1.13 looks exactly like mine and according to the manual is off a 19J engine, with one belt crankshaft to pas pump and the other belt crankshaft to alternator to fan.

The engine number is 11L 22543A which I understand is 200TDi but I'm a bit confused about the belt arrangement. Is the 19J arrangement the same on the 200TDi? The manual says to measure the tension between the coolant pump and the power steering pump pulleys, but as far as I can tell there is not a belt between these two.

The double pulley on the end of the crankshaft will need replacing because there are two big chunks missing from the edge of the V which has undoubtedly caused the failure of my fan belt. The belt itself looks like it's been shredded along the sides.

Fear ye not, the belt arrangement is the same on the 200tdi and 19J (turbo diesel), i swapped my old turbo for a 200tdi lump on my old 90 and they are very similar.

200tdi looks like this:
formatting link
Look at the rocker cover, should be "finned", the old 19J had a domed one similar to most old land rovers
